Reading Roselle, NJ beyond the headline numbers

Roselle sits inside Union County, New Jersey, at roughly 40.65°N, -74.26°W. Population 21,670, $92,762 median household income. Median home value $379,900, median rent $1,567. Poverty rate 9.5%, read against that income figure since two cities on the same median can differ underneath it.

CDC PLACES: Roselle's highest-prevalence health measure is short sleep duration at 44.8%, then high blood pressure at 36.5%.

What is the population of Roselle, NJ?
Roselle, NJ has a population of 21,670 people, located in Union County, New Jersey.
What is the median household income in Roselle?
The median household income in Roselle, NJ is $92,762 per year, per the U.S. Census ACS. The poverty rate is 9.5%.
What is the median home value in Roselle?
The median home value in Roselle, NJ is $379,900. Median rent is $1,567/month.
What are the top health concerns in Roselle?
The top health indicators in Roselle include Short Sleep Duration (44.8%), High Blood Pressure (36.5%), Obesity (33.6%). Data from CDC PLACES.
What is the median age in Roselle?
The median age in Roselle, NJ is 39.4 years. 27.1% of residents have a bachelor's degree or higher.
